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ary vs.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ical
Both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ary and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ical College are Private, 4 years schools located in New York. The following statements compare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ary and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ical's tuition ($13,500) is more expensive than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ary ($12,800).

-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ical's students to faculty ratio (14 to 1) is lower than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ary (15 to 1).
-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ary (187 students) is larger than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ical (142 students) with more enrolled students.
-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ical ($12,988) has higher amount of financial aid than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ary ($12,042).
- Kehilath Yakov Rabbinical Seminary's graduation rate (50%) is higher than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ical (14%).
